How small businesses and schools get boxed in

The problem isn’t that these agencies don’t care - it’s that their systems are built for scale, not individuality. When you’re managing dozens or hundreds of clients, the easiest path is to funnel everyone through the same process:

  • the same content calendars

  • the same AI-generated captions

  • the same ad-spend recommendations

  • the same “growth-metrics” that don’t reflect real identity

It’s efficient for them - but it’s costly for the business owner and school leader who ends up with a digital presence that feels nothing like their own actual identity.

And the biggest cost isn’t just financial.

It’s the erosion of identity and the story of what makes their presence unique.
